    no satellite signal is being received 29

    i recently install sky dish in my new house but i getting error no satellite signal is being recived code 29 i did signal test network id 0000 transport stream 0000 signal quality nothing lock indicator not locked

    Error message 29 usually indicates that the box is not 'seeing' the default transponder. Have a look at ( Services>4>01 Select ) the Default Transponder settings, and make sure the values are 11.778, V, 27.5. 2/3. Reset ( red button ) and Save New Settings.

      Or try this.

      To reset the LNB:

      1. Press services on your Sky remote control.
      2. Highlight System Setup using the up/down arrows and press select.
      3. Press 0, then 1, then select.
      4. Press select again to access the LNB setup screen.
      5. Using the up/down arrows, highlight LNB Power Supply.
      6. Using the left/right arrows change the setting to off.
      7. Using the up/down arrows, highlight 22KHz command.
      8. Using left/right arrows change to off.
      9. Using the up/down arrows, highlight Save New Settings and press select.
      10. Press sky followed by services.
      11. Highlight System Setup and press select.
      12. Press 0 then 1 then select.
      13. Press select again to access the LNB setup screen.
      14. Press the red button to re-set the default settings.
      15. Using the up/down arrows, highlight Save New Settings and press select.
      16. Press select to confirm that the settings have been reset.

      The correct settings are:
      - 9.75 for the low frequency.
      - 10.60 for the high frequency.
      - The LNB power supply should always be set to on.
      - The 22KHz Command should always be set to on.

      17. Press sky to return to normal viewing. It may take 60 seconds for the picture to appear. If this issue is affecting the playback of recorded material, you will need to make a new recording to check whether this procedure has resolved the issue.
